L.A.’s newest plant-based consumer packaged food company introduces its new gourmet ready-to-bake 100% plant-based lasagna featuring Pulled Oats® now available for home delivery while donating 25% of all profits to directly benefit Support + Feed and help fight climate change one meal at a time.
FYI, Pulled Oats® are a combination of oats, faba beans, pea protein, and salt that manages to replicate the consistency of meat. The lasagna comes ready to bake and in approximately an hour’s time, you will have a hearty and delicious plant-based lasagna that tastes good and is good for you.
Vegan Sunday Supper was created by Founder Richard Klein, a sought-after brand strategist, and a committed advocate for promoting global equality. Vegan Sunday Supper is a project of passion for Klein who transitioned to a plant-based diet 15 years ago when he found himself constantly trying to recreate delicious vegan versions of the dishes he loved growing up, including lasagna.
Klein eventually teamed up with Italian American Chef Vincent Giovanni, the chef that created Laurel Hardware’s bona fide pizza program. Next, Klein and Giovanni needed to create the finest and freshest plant-based lasagna noodles, so they turned to Restaurateur & Executive Chef Celestino Drago (Drago Centro, IL Pastaio, Drago Bakery & Drago Restaurant Group), the patriarch of the famous Drago brothers who has played an integral role in the ever-evolving dining scene in Los Angeles for over three decades.
Klein and his new Vegan Sunday Supper culinary family came together and cooked up a delectably delicious 100% Plant-Based Lasagna. This lasagna is a completely new take on the traditional sausage recipe, with sweet peppers and vegan cheeses, but there is a very special secret ingredient, Pulled Oats®, which makes this Lasagna just as satisfying and delicious as a traditional meat Lasagna, without the meat.
Vegan Sunday Supper will donate 25% of its profits to Support + Feed, a non-profit organization created during the pandemic by Maggie Baird (actress, voice artist, screenwriter), while fighting climate change one meal at a time. This incredible group based in L.A. provides plant-based meals prepared by local businesses to people experiencing food insecurity. Food scarcity has augmented, particularly with the increasing number of people in food apartheids, plagued by food insecurity. Support + Feed works tirelessly to nourish those in need and has now established itself as a community resource in four cities, assisting local nonprofits with nourishing plant-based meals and informational resources on its nutritional benefits.
